Free Updates from Digidesign!

DigidesignDigidesign® Pro Tools LE™ and Pro Tools M-Powered™ 7.1.1 software are free updates that support Apple's new Intel-based iMac, MacBook Pro, and Mac Mini computers. Both updates run natively on Intel-based Macs, making full use of the host computer's processing power. These updates are only for Intel-based Macs.

DigidesignUpdated installers for the Music Production Toolkit and DV Toolkit™ 2 software expansion options are available as downloads and as part of the 7.1.1 installation CDs. Updated installers for Digidesign and Digidesign-distributed plug-ins will be included with the 7.1.1 update. Customers should check with all other third-party plug-in manufacturers for Intel-based Mac-compatible versions of their plug-ins.

Features

• Native support for Intel-based iMac, MacBook Pro, and Mac Mini
• Free update for registered Pro Tools LE 7 and all Pro Tools M-Powered users
• Support for Music Production Toolkit and DV Toolkit 2 software expansion options
• Updated Digidesign and Digidesign-distributed plug-ins

Post Production on a Budget
Need a full-fledged post system but can't afford Pro Tools HD? Get DV Toolkit 2 for Pro Tools LE. DV Toolkit adds support for SMPTE Time Code + Feet and Frames, OMF, AAF, MXF, MP3, DigiBase Pro and up to 48 stereo tracks. It also comes with TL Space Native Edition convolution reverb, Synchro Arts VocAligh Project time-alignment tool and DINR LE noise reduction.

To take things a step further, add a Canopus ADVC-55 and you can now output the video track to an NTSC display. Perfect for voice over/ADR, freeing up display real estate or impressing clients.

Acoustical Treatment - Cheaper Than You Think
The biggest problem facing home studios is the home itself. No matter how great a recording system you have, you are still at the mercy of your room's acoustics. Small rooms in particular have many early reflections that create a world of problems. When recording, they make things sound boxy and unnatural. They can also cause some frequencies to either disappear or become overbearing, making it very difficult to capture great sounds. When mixing, bad sounding rooms make it impossible to accurately judge EQ, levels and reverbs.

People will regularly drop a thousand dollars on a microphone, preamp or compressor, but make the mistake of ignoring this critical step in the chain. Generally this is because they believe the cost of treating a room to be prohibitive. Fortunately, it is actually cheaper than most people realize. Control Surfaces - Make Mixing Fun Again
The best parts of digital audio? Affordable, convenient and a wealth of great sounding options. The worst part? Mixing with a mouse. Tired of not being able to move two, three or four faders at once? Tired of bad ergonomics? Tired of staring at a screen when you're trying to be creative? You can change all of that. Control surfaces let you work faster and more creatively. Get back to the feel of analog boards, but keep the convenience of automation with motorized faders. Control levels, panning, plug-in parameters, transports and many other features without ever needing to touch a mouse.
